It worries me how many threads talk about low performance. I'm about to build out a replica 3 setup and run Ovirt with a bunch of Windows VMs.
Are the issues Tony is experiencing "normal" for Gluster? Does anyone here have a system with windows VMs and have good performance? *Vincent Royer* *778-825-1057* <http://www.epicenergy.ca/> *SUSTAINABLE MOBILE ENERGY SOLUTIONS* On Wed, May 2, 2018 at 7:52 AM Tony Hoyle <[email protected]> wrote: > On 01/05/2018 02:27, Thing wrote: > > Hi, > > > > So is the KVM or Vmware as the host(s)? I basically have the same setup > > ie 3 x 1TB "raid1" nodes and VMs, but 1gb networking. I do notice with > > vmware using NFS disk was pretty slow (40% of a single disk) but this > > was over 1gb networking which was clearly saturating. Hence I am moving > > to KVM to use glusterfs hoping for better performance and bonding, it > > will be interesting to see which host type runs faster. > > 1gb will always be the bottleneck in that situation - that's going too > max out at the speed of a single disk or lower. You need at minimum to > bond interfaces and preferably go to 10gb to do that. > > Our NFS actually ends up faster than local disk because the read speed > of the raid is faster than the read speed of the local disk. > > > Which operating system is gluster on? > > Debian Linux. Supermicro motherboards, 24 core i7 with 128GB of RAM on > the VM hosts. > > > Did you do iperf between all nodes? > > Yes, around 9.7Gb/s > > It doesn't appear to be raw read speed but iowait. Under nfs load with > multiple VMs I get an iowait of around 0.3%. Under gluster, never less > than 10% and glusterfsd is often the top of the CPU usage. This causes > a load average of ~12 compared to 3 over NFS, and absolutely kills VMs > esp. Windows ones - one machine I set booting and it was still booting > 30 minutes later! > > Tony > _______________________________________________ > Gluster-users mailing list > [email protected] > http://lists.gluster.org/mailman/listinfo/gluster-users
